Recognizing Pre-Operative Prep Work for Glaucoma Surgery



Prior to undertaking glaucoma surgery, it's essential to understand the pre-operative preparations that can help make certain a smooth experience.

Start by reviewing your current medicines with your medical professional; they may encourage you to stop specific ones briefly. Arranging for an adventure home is vital, as you won't have the ability to drive post-surgery.

It's additionally important to prepare your home for recuperation-- remove any tripping hazards and have your recovery products on hand.

Follow your doctor's instructions regarding consuming and drinking before the treatment, as this can differ.

Last but not least, think about having a person accompany you for psychological assistance; it can make a difference.

What Occurs During the Glaucoma Surgical Procedure Treatment?



Throughout glaucoma surgical treatment, your specialist will thoroughly execute the procedure while ensuring your comfort and safety.

You'll receive regional anesthetic to numb the location, so you won't really feel discomfort. Depending on the technique used, your specialist might create a tiny cut or utilize a laser to enhance fluid drainage in your eye.

Throughout the surgery, they'll check your vital indications and the condition of your eye carefully. The treatment generally lasts regarding 30 to 60 minutes.

You might experience some moderate pressure or a feeling of movement, yet it should not be uneasy.

As soon as the surgical treatment is total, your specialist will certainly review what to anticipate instantly later, establishing the phase for your recovery trip.

Essential Post-Operative Treatment and Healing Tips



After your glaucoma surgical treatment, it's crucial to follow your doctor's post-operative treatment guidelines to make certain a smooth healing.

Prevent arduous tasks, bending over, or heavy lifting for at least a few weeks. Secure your eyes from intense lights and stay clear of scrubing them.

Attend all follow-up visits to monitor your healing development. If you experience raised pain, redness, or vision adjustments, contact your medical professional right away.

Remaining hydrated and maintaining a balanced diet regimen can additionally sustain your recuperation. Keep in mind, patience is crucial; provide your eyes time to recover effectively.
